 Midpoint of PQ=(52,12)  =R
Slope of OR= 15
Slope of axis =    15
(  Line joining the point of intersection of tangents at A and B on parabola and mid-point of chord AB is always parallel to axis of parabola)
  Slope of directrix = -5
Eq.of directrix:  y=-5x   5x+y=0
Circle with OP as diameter:  x2+y23x3y=0
Circle with OQ as diameter:  x2+y22x+2y=0
Focus is the point of intersection of circles:  S=(3013,613)
Eq.of line joining origin to focus is: x+5y=0
